White Fillings
Many people are rejecting the use of silver amalgam in their mouth for either a perceived health concern or for looks. We no longer restore with silver amalgam In our office. Dentistry has better materials to use, in your mouth today, that are kinder to your oral structures. There are two types of white fillings used. The first are plastic white fillings that are completed in the office in one visit. There cost is higher than a silver amalgam filling but can last as long. The second method is a laboratory made white restoration, which is referred to as either an inlay or an onlay. They have a beautiful look within the tooth and many times are indistinguishable from the natural remaining tooth. An inlay (or onlay) allows us to preserve more of the natural tooth surface. They are bonded into the preparation and on a microscopic level become a part of the tooth -- thus strengthening a tooth that had been weakened by decay. The white fillings can be done as you upgrade your dentistry.

Cosmetic Contouring
Cosmetic contouring is the simplest cosmetic dental procedure. Usually the edges of the upper and lower front teeth are reshaped and contoured to create a more pleasing smile. This does not require the use of a local anesthetic. The improvements are seen immediately. The results are long lasting and at a minimal cost. This treatment is ideal for those who are basically happy with the shade of their teeth but are displeased with the chipping or slight crowding of them.

Implants
Implants are a titanium cylinder placed in the jawbone to imitate a mot. A collar attached to the cylinder emerges above the gum on which a crown (cap) can be placed. Do these substitutes work? YES. And in many situations their ability to function rivals that of the natural tooth. Implants can be placed in an edentulous (no teeth) situation to construct a denture which is as solid and as comfortable as natural teeth. Individual teeth can be restored through implants in addition to dentures. Numerous continuing education hours must be completed to competently place and restore implants. The use of implants aid in the control of bone shrinkage, eating efficiency, and providing support to the facial muscles, all of which are affected when teeth are missing. Although costly, dental implants are one of the best treatment alternatives for people who have lost one tooth or numerous teeth. When placed and properly maintained these substitutes appear natural and function as well as natural teeth.
